Me too!!! I've tried a lot of products...what I like is aussie root lift, which is a liquid pump spray on that you put at the roots when wet and blow dry upside down. Muss your roots with your fingers as you dry it. Then, I use a large curling iron haphazardly, different directions, wrapping more around the roots than the end. My hair is collar length and choppy layered. Length can make your hair look thinner. Finally, I use a molding gum called D-Fi (supercuts sells it among other salons). Not the gel one, but the white one. Rub it on fingers and then run fingers through underside of hair, mussing it up a bit. Lasts all day (and through sleeping actually).

From wet to ready to go takes me ~ 30-35 mins.

Oh yeah! Using a non-ammonia color or glaze will coat each hair, adding volume. The storebought types that wash out in 28 washes are great--you could just match your color if you didn't want to change it.
